"We were both lost, but we found ourselves in each other. She tries to save me from myself but her love doesn't seem to be enough.I want something more. Call me selfish, but I want her soul for myself. I want her light to be mine. I want to take it all away from her. Her love will never be enough to fill my soulless dark hole, and one day, she will realize it. I'm just hoping it won't be too late for her because in my own twisted way, I do love her." Jabari grapples through life with heavy, unresolved trauma from his early life, until he meets Venus, a young woman battling her own traumas, and he is forced to finally unearth the demons he had buried deep and face them.
